Enhancing Operational Efficiency with Flat Sheet Membrane Systems in Treatment Plants

Flat Sheet Membrane Elements have actually arised as a keystone technology in the realm of water purification and wastewater treatment. Their style and capability are pivotal in a variety of applications, including local water therapy, commercial effluents, and also in the food and drink market. The flat sheet arrangement permits membrane layers to be arranged closely together, making the most of the active area for filtration while reducing space demands.

As we delve deeper right into the possibilities supplied by flat sheet membrane systems, we encounter a variety of specific products, notably Flat Sheet Membrane Modules. These modules are designed to house numerous flat sheet membrane elements, yet they keep a modular style that supplies adaptability in scaling procedures. Among the standout attributes of these modules is their simplicity of installation and maintenance. By permitting the substitute of private membrane elements without needing to interfere with the whole system, they afford drivers the freedom to handle their possessions with minimal downtime. In addition, the style can frequently boost operational resilience; must one membrane aspect deal with fouling or deterioration, the remaining elements remain to execute, hence making sure that the treatment plant preserves its output capability.

Additional improving the flexibility of membrane technology are MBR Double Deck Modules. These innovative systems leverage a two-tier layout that raises operational efficiency while catching the benefits of both conventional and membrane-based purification. Double deck setups permit a higher thickness of membrane elements within the exact same footprint, properly increasing the filtering capacity without calling for extra space. This is particularly advantageous in setups where growth is limited, and extra floor room can not be produced. The combination of raised capability and boosted splitting up performance makes double deck modules a video game changer for facilities intending to optimize their procedure while encountering boosted regulative stress and resource restraints.
